New Orleans Seven women have filed a federal class action lawsuit against Louisiana State University, its governing board and several former and current LSU officials, alleging years of “neglect and dysfunction” in its responses to allegations of sexual harassment, domestic violence and assault involving student-athletes.
The suit filed Monday in Baton Rouge alleges a racketeering scheme by LSU, its athletic department and the nonprofit fundraising Tiger Athletic Foundation also a defendant in the lawsuit to insulate players and coaches from sexual misconduct allegations.
Players and coaches were shielded so as not to hinder the financial success of athletic programs, the lawsuit says. The result, the lawsuit claims, meant women were discouraged or blocked from taking claims of harassment or assault to the university office responsible for handling such complaints in accordance with federal Title IX sexual discrimination laws.
